Transaction 2099505656bb6e1cd5132e02bbec186c28b32c8c7276448fdc7583b637123a22

1 Input
2 Outputs
  • 2099505656bb6e1cd5132e02bbec186c28b32c8c7276448fdc7583b637123a22:0
  • value  2103441
    address  32mh1DxPYbhZE1LVQYqednbuYmAHFZydvP
  • 2099505656bb6e1cd5132e02bbec186c28b32c8c7276448fdc7583b637123a22:1
  • value  1170607
    address  3GEjRTHxMPPEoxQUJ3NVRHJnrU2yjLCdq9